1. A method for transmitting a frame in a WLAN, wherein in the WLAN, an Access Point (AP) is shared by at least one virtual APs, or, the AP is shared by multiple Basic Service Set Identities (BSSIDs), and each virtual AP associates with an BSSID, the method comprising:

  • setting, by the AP, an element corresponding to each of the multiple BSSIDs and a Partial Virtual Bitmap in a Beacon frame;

    wherein the Partial Virtual Bitmap includes a broadcast/multicast indication bit corresponding to each of the multiple BSSIDs, which is used to indicating whether there is a broadcast/multicast (group addressed) frame buffered in the AP for a Station (STA) associates with each of the multiple BSSIDs;

    the element includes an index field and an DTIM Count field, wherein the index field is configured to identify a BSSID among the multiple BSSIDs;

    the DTIM Count field associates with the BSSID in the index field, and the DTIM Count field is configured to notify the STA whether the Beacon frame is a DTIM Beacon, which is used to notify the STA when to wake up to receive the buffered broadcast/multicast frame;

    sending out the Beacon frame.
